Terrain

Classic ‘long’ style orienteering with a great mix of spur-gully and gold mining features.  The hills are not too big and running is quite fast in most areas.

Courses

# Name Distance # controls Description
1 Long Hard 10 km hard navigation and more physically demanding
2 Medium Hard
(Men’s Championship)
8 km a shorter version of course 1
3 Short Hard
(Women’s Championship)
4.5 km hard navigation but less physically demanding
4 Moderate
(Junior Championship)
3.5 km easier navigation using a mix of tracks and cross-country legs, easier control locations and catching features
5 Easy 2.5 km easy navigation and all legs on tracks or following obvious linear features

Note: Course distances are direct and will vary based on route choice.  Expect to travel between 20% and 50% further than stated distances.
